WASSCE 2020 postponed, BECE 2020 to be postponed and rescheduled if it becomes extremely necessary. WASSCE 2020 Postponed, and the WASSCE time table has been suspended according to a press release sighted by NewsGhana24.com dated 20th March 2020 and signed by E.K Myers, the registrar. However, the examining body is yet to come out with a memo on the 2020 BECE.
According to our sources, the BECE is yet to be decided on. It is possible that the 2020 BECE will not be postponed since the exams is three months from now.

Which Countries write the WASSCE?
The West African Senior School Certificate Examination (WASSCE) is a type of exam in West Africa. It is made by the West African Examinations Council (WAEC). It is only given to students who live in the five English-speaking West African countries, Nigeria, Ghana, Sierra Leone, The Gambia, and Liberia.
Has WASSCE 2020 been canceled or postponed?
Yes the WASSCE 2020 has postponed until further notice. This decision is because of the COVID-19 pandemic. The council will announce a new date when the health challenge that has wrecked the entire world is put under control.
